one of my staff deleted the default games (solitaire,
freecell, etc.)under accessories\games folder on the Start
menu. Is there an easy way to restore them? Have checked
MS Knosledge Base and it gave instrux where you had to go
to Setup but the compressesd folder is nowhere to be
found. Help!!
 
G

Ganjam

You can find all those games in the C:\WINNT\System32
folder if you are using MS2000 else in C:\Windows\System
folder. Create a short cut to the desktop and then cut &
paste the short cut to the Accessories in the
Start>Programs>Accessories>Games.... Simple !!!!
